Dystonia can be a heralding symptom of Parkinson's disease (PD), but more frequently occurs as a levodopa-induced phenomenon during the course of sustained treatment. "Off" period dystonia is the most common form and mainly affects the feet; peak-dose dystonia occurs predominantly in the face/ neck,
